    Class ButtonBackgroundSize

    The base layout component for a button or UI elements - easily build UI with Unity Primitives. Helps to create consistency by using values that scale to a designer's 2D layout program. Based on a ratio of 2048 pixels for 1 meter of surface area.

    Use case: A designer creates a concept image of UI based on a 2048 artboard. 2048 pixels is a nice resolution for a meter of content, two meters away from the user. The FOV of the HoloLens is about 1 meter wide at 2 meters from the user meaning the designer can assume an image area of 2048 x 1184 pixels at 2 meters from the user. The designer or engineer can take pixel based redlines and create UI at 1:1 scale.
